Remembering the Kuerners...Andrew Wyeth's Neighbor
Glenn Cuerden's recent Book, yet to be published.
This well-researched, 272-page book contains 232 large photographs. The 24,000 word naritave documents the flavor and significance of the Kuerners and their farmstead (previously documented in numerous paintings and watercolors -- famously executed by Andrew Wyeth over a fifty-year period). Glenn's photography is reminicent of Wyeth's artistic style in honestly capturing the mystique and and brittle, old-world values of Anna Kuerner in this Chadds Ford, Pennslyvania village.
